An altered onomatopoeia, derived from "sniff", as when one is overcome with emotion.
An utterance used to convey emotion, most commonly representing tears.
When preceded by a " / "
or enclosed by two " * "s
The phrase could be a variation of an "emote" used in online games to express to other players (via text) being overcome by emotion, as evidenced by a supposed runny nose, and possibly hidden tears.
